This is Ubuntu 18.04.  I have a static IP and default route configured.  I’m using Ansible to provision these machines.

I logged into the console on the box and ran ‘watch “ip route show”’ - to keep an eye on the routing table.  As soon as ansible installed FRR - my default route was gone.

I see this in the logs on the box:

Aug  9 16:24:41 ubuntu frr[2186]: Removing all routes made by FRR.

Technically the default route was there before FRR.  So if that is what is removing it - color me confused.  Once this happens - ansible gets stuck (my ansible is running from a box on a different subnet and therefore needs the default route to stay stable).

Can someone explain this behavior to me ?  Is there something I can do ?  Put a temp static route in for my ansible host ?  Add a route in a manner that FRR won’t touch it yet ?  Would it help to have FRR config in place beforehand (I can do this in ansible easy enough) ?
